- The motion prevailed, a majority of the members serving voting therefor. By unanimous consent the Senate returned to the order of Third Reading of Bills Senator Lauwers moved that the Senate proceed to consideration of the following bills: House Bill No. 4491 House Bill No. 6071 The motion prevailed. The following bill was read a third time: House Bill No. 4491, entitled A bill to amend 1954 PA 116, entitled “Michigan election law,” by amending sections 14b, 24k, 509o, 510, 761d, 765, and 765b (MCL 168.14b, 168.24k, 168.509o, 168.510, 168.761d, 168.765, and 168.765b), sections 14b, 24k, and 761d as added and sections 765 and 765b as amended by 2020 PA 177 and section 509o as amended by 2018 PA 126. The question being on the passage of the bill, The bill was passed, a majority of the members serving voting therefor, as follows:
